草庐IT

同步到Kafka

全部标签

技术复盘:用指令帧同步做 Unity RTS 网游/手游

    这个项目目前由于各种原因已经结束了,最终没能做到上架那一步,不过RTS的所有坑都踩了一遍。本人是RTS游戏爱好者,这篇文章先泛泛谈一下关键技术问题的遇到的大坑。后面有空再补上细节和代码。一、最重要的问题是网络同步,没有之一    对于RTS,最重要的就是网络同步问题,无法回避,影响全局,甚至决定成败。0)网游?局域网游戏?    这个问题必须首先回答,如果你选择了网游,首先扪心自问:有没有足够的启动资金。    如果没有足够的启动资金,而又决定做网游RTS,那么这条道路是极其艰辛的,具体看下面。1)状态同步/帧同步/指令帧同步/网络状态指令帧同步的选择    同步方式:本地玩家的数据和

大厂咋做多系统数据同步方案的?

1背景业务线与系统越来越多,系统或业务间数据同步需求也越频繁。当前互联网业务系统大多MySQL数据存储与处理方案:随信息时代爆炸,大数据量场景下慢慢凸显短板,如:需对大量数据全文检索,对大量数据组合查询,分库分表后的数据聚合查询自然想到如何使用其他更适合处理该类问题的数据组件(ES)因此,公司亟需一套灵活易用的系统间数据同步与处理方案,让特定业务数据可很方便在其他业务或组件间流转,助推业务快速迭代。2方案选型当前业界针对系统数据同步较常见的方案有同步双写、异步双写、侦听binlog等方式,各有优劣。本文以MySQL同步到ES案例讲解。2.1同步双写最简单方案,在将数据写到MySQL时,同时将数

kafka权限认证 topic权限认证 权限动态认证-亲测成功

kafka权限认证topic权限认证权限动态认证-亲测成功kafka动态认证自定义认证安全认证-亲测成功MacBookLinux安装KafkaLinux解压安装Kafka介绍1、Kafka的权限分类身份认证(Authentication):对client与服务器的连接进行身份认证,brokers和zookeeper之间的连接进行Authentication(producer和consumer)、其他brokers、tools与brokers之间连接的认证。上一篇博文介绍了连接的身份认证。权限控制(Authorization):实现对于消息级别的权限控制,clients的读写操作进行Author

用于获取从 iTunes 同步到 IOS 设备的视频的 IOS API

我正在尝试编写一个IOS应用程序,除其他外,它可以获取从iTunes同步到IOS设备(应用程序正在运行的设备)的视频。我尝试过使用AssetsLibrary和PhotosFramework。我只能获取照片应用程序可访问的那些Assets(框架文档也证实了这一点)但是,视频应用程序能够获取从iTunes同步的那些视频。是否有一些公共(public)API可用于访问同步视频?或者这是设计使然?我遇到的一个解决方法是转到iTunes中的“照片”部分并打开“包含视频”并将视频(另一个副本)同步为“照片”,照片应用程序和我的应用程序现在都可以访问它。这是唯一的出路吗?

Kafka入门基本概念(详细)

什么是kafkaKafka是一种高吞吐量的分布式发布订阅消息系统(消息引擎系统),它可以处理消费者在网站中的所有动作流数据。这种动作(网页浏览,搜索和其他用户的行动)是在现代网络上的许多社会功能的一个关键因素。这些数据通常是由于吞吐量的要求而通过处理日志和日志聚合来解决。对于像Hadoop一样的日志数据和离线分析系统,但又要求实时处理的限制,这是一个可行的解决方案。Kafka的目的是通过Hadoop的并行加载机制来统一线上和离线的消息处理,也是为了通过集群来提供实时的消息其实我们简单点理解就是系统A发送消息给kafka(消息引擎系统),系统B从kafka中读取A发送的消息。而kafka就是个中

ios - 同步执行 RACSignal

我目前正在开发WatchKit应用程序,但我目前遇到此给定方法的问题:-(void)application:(UIApplication*)applicationhandleWatchKitExtensionRequest:(NSDictionary*)userInforeply:(void(^)(NSDictionary*replyInfo))reply我的网络客户端构建在ReactiveCocoa之上,所有内容都是异步执行的。对于AppDelegate中的这个方法,我需要在方法完成之前触发回复响应,所以我想知道是否有方法阻止方法完成,直到RACSignal完成(subscribeC

Kafka快速入门

文章目录Kafka快速入门1、相关概念介绍前言1.1基本介绍1.2常见消息队列的比较1.3Kafka常见相关概念介绍2、安装Kafka3、初体验前期准备编码测试配置介绍bug记录Kafka快速入门1、相关概念介绍前言在当今信息爆炸的时代,实时数据处理已经成为许多应用程序和系统不可或缺的一部分。ApacheKafka作为一个高吞吐量、低延迟的分布式消息队列系统,广泛应用于构建实时数据管道、流式处理应用等场景。无论是大数据分析、日志收集、监控告警还是在线机器学习模型等,Kafka都发挥着重要的作用。本快速入门指南将带您进入Kafka的世界,探索其核心概念和基本操作。我们将从安装和配置开始,逐步介绍

ios - 有什么方法可以同步 Map Vector(OpenGL 层)和 UIKit?

假设您使用GMSMapView之上的UIImageView在屏幕中间固定了一个图钉。在流程中的某个时刻,我需要移除固定图钉并将其添加为map中的标记。可以通过将固定图钉hidden属性设置为true然后使用GMSMarker在map中心添加一个与UIImageView相同的资源。这是可行的,除了存在视觉故障,因为添加标记会触及OpenGL层,无论隐藏引脚是否使用UIKit。有没有办法同步这两个操作? 最佳答案 不是真的。参见thisquestion关于OpenGL-UIKit同步的讨论——结论是Apple可以访问私有(private

大数据Hadoop、HDFS、Hive、HBASE、Spark、Flume、Kafka、Storm、SparkStreaming这些概念你是否能理清?

1.HadoopHadoop是大数据开发的重要框架,是一个由Apache基金会所开发的分布式系统基础架构,其核心是HDFS和MapReduce,HDFS为海量的数据提供了存储,MapReduce为海量的数据提供了计算,在Hadoop2.x时代,增加了Yarn,Yarn只负责资源的调度。目前hadoop包括hdfs、mapreduce、yarn、核心组件。hdfs用于存储,mapreduce用于计算,yarn用于资源管理。2HDFSHDFS是什么?HadoopDistributedFileSystem:分步式文件系统源自于Google的GFS论文,发表于2003年10月,HDFS是GFS克隆版H

【运维】Kafka高可用: KRaft(不依赖zookeeper)集群搭建

文章目录一.kafkakraft集群介绍1.KRaft架构2.Controller服务器3.ProcessRoles4.QuorumVoters5.kraft的工作原理ing二.集群安装1.安装1.1.配置1.2.格式化2.启动测试2.1.启功节点服务2.2.测试本文主要介绍了kafkaraft集群架构:与旧架构的不同点,有哪些优势,哪些问题架构成员有哪些,怎么规划。三节点集群安装、启动与测试一.kafkakraft集群介绍1.KRaft架构在旧的架构中Kafka集群包含多个broker节点和一个ZooKeeper集群。如上图集群结构:4个broker节点和3个ZooKeeper节点。Kafk